Respect the Environment
Humans are in a sense outside of nature in that our actions and purposes may not be limited by nature in the sense that all other creatures on earth are limited. This gives us a unique ability and resposibility with regard to the environment. We can preserve and enhance it or we can destroy it. Our spiritual responsibility is to protect the environment so that we pass a healthy and vibrant planet and biosphere on to our descendants.

Brief History of the Baha'i Faith
A Brief History of the Baha'i Faith
In the early 1800s people in many cultures around the globe expected a major religion event.
In North America, William Miller preached that Jesus would return in 1844 based on his underatanding of passages in the Old and New Testaments. Some spiritual leaders of the Indian tribes also spoke of a new religious leader who would appear to restore spiritual unity to the peoples of the world.

The Baha'i Scriptures
The key scriptures of the Baha'i Faith are available to any one in 100s of languages today. They can be purchased from Baha'i organizations in most countries. They are available in many bookstores and in online bookstores. They can be found in many public libraries. They can also be downloaded at no cost as PDF or text files - to be read on a computer or printed on your printer. You can use our Contact link to request help with finding a book.
